The bookworm in me loves to see it.<\/p>\n<p>The instigator behind this smutty read-a-thon was none other than New York City Mayor Zohran Mamdani. During a Sunday news conference, Mamdani was carrying out his mayoral duties, including telling people to stay home and safe from the winter storm, when he dropped the unexpected recommendation.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e snow is coming down heavily across our city and I can think of no better excuse for New Yorkers to stay home, take a long nap, or take advantage of our public library\u2019s offer of free access to Heated Rivalry on e-book or audiobook for anyone with a library card,\u201d Mamdani said.<\/p>\n<p>The effects of the mayor\u2019s book rec were seen immediately. The New York Public Library saw a 529% increase in the number of downloads of Heated Rivalry after Mamdani\u2019s news conference, according to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nytimes.com\/2026\/01\/26\/nyregion\/mamdani-heated-rivalry-library.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">The New York Times<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>Library spokesperson Lizzie Tribone said that 86% of the downloads occurred after the mayor\u2019s endorsement. A spokeswoman for Mamdani said he hadn\u2019t read Heated Rivalry but was \u201cvery excited to see so much enthusiasm about using the resources of the public library.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The New York Public Library made an unlimited number of copies of Heated Rivalry, part of the Game Changers series, available on its app on Saturday. Since that day, Heated Rivalry has been downloaded from the library more than 5,000 times. The six books in the series have more than 13,000 downloads.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e expect this number to continue to climb,\u201d Tribone said.<\/p>\n<p>The e-book and audiobook versions of Heated Rivalry and all the other books in the Gamechangers series will be <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nypl.org\/blog\/2026\/01\/24\/instant-access-heated-rivalry-game-changers-series\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">available for free via the New York Public Library<\/a> through Valentine\u2019s Day on February 14.<\/p>\n<p>Now a global streaming sensation, Heated Rivalry is one book in a series by Rachel Reid. It tells the story of a secret romance between two closeted gay hockey players, Shane Hollander and Ilya Rozanov. Spoiler alert: There is a lot of smut in the book and the HBO series.<\/p>\n<p>Since the show\u2019s release in November, the book has soared in popularity, making it very hard to find across the country.
